Responsibilities for this Position
ROLE AND POSITION OBJECTIVES:
The Mechanical Parts Commodity Engineer is responsible for managing the technical and sourcing aspects of mechanical components across the supply chain. This includes collaborating with engineering, manufacturing, and procurement teams to ensure the quality, cost-effectiveness, and reliability of mechanical parts such as fasteners, machined components, castings, and molded parts. The role involves evaluating suppliers, ensuring compliance with industry standards, and driving continuous improvement initiatives to align with business objectives.
